Before diving into Pisces compatibility, let's understand Pisces itself. As the twelfth sign of the zodiac, people born under Pisces are known for their empathetic, artistic, and intuitive nature. Governed by Neptune, they often have a deep connection to the spiritual and mystical realms. Pisceans seek harmony in relationships and value deep, emotional bonds. As we progress into 2024 and beyond, the gentle Pisces will continue to seek partners who appreciate their sensitive and nurturing character.
When it comes to the most harmonious relationships, Pisces often finds solace in the company of fellow Water signs—Cancer and Scorpio. The intuitive connection between Water signs leads to a natural understanding and shared emotional language. Cancer's nurturing approach and Scorpio's intensity can complement the compassionate nature of Pisces, leading to deep and meaningful partnerships. These relationships are often underpinned by a strong sense of mutual care and spiritual depth that remains relevant in the astrological forecasts for the coming years.
The grounded nature of Earth signs can provide the stability and practicality that a dreamy Pisces might lack. Taurus, Virgo, and Capricorn offer a solid foundation for Pisces, allowing them to feel secure while pursuing their creative or spiritual interests. Taurus, especially, with its love for comfort and luxury, can help Pisces feel pampered, while Pisces brings romance and whimsy to the relationship, creating a well-balanced and nurturing dynamic that stands strong as the stars shift in the sky.
Fiery signs such as Aries, Leo, and Sagittarius could present a challenge for the sensitive Pisces, as their bold nature might sometimes be overwhelming for the soft-spoken Fish. However, with understanding and compromise, these relationships can offer growth and vitality to Pisces. Air signs, Gemini, Libra, and Aquarius, can stimulate Pisces intellectually, but their sometimes detached approach to emotions might clash with the desire for Pisces to connect on a deeper level. As the celestial bodies continue their dance, the unpredictable yet potential-filled pairings with Fire and Air signs present a continual source of learning for Pisces.
A Pisces pairing with another Pisces can be a double-edged sword. On one hand, they understand each other's desires for emotional depth and are attuned to each other's needs, fostering a telepathic-like connection. On the other hand, the tendency towards escapism and a lack of practical grounding could lead to challenges, particularly when facing the harsh realities of life. However, as astrological insights evolve, this Piscean connection may grow stronger, provided they learn to navigate the material world together.
For Pisces, achieving balance in relationships is crucial. Whether it's with an opposing Sun sign or a more traditionally compatible one, Pisces thrives when they and their partners learn from each other and grow. The planetary transits and positions in 2024 and onward suggest that for Pisces, the key to compatibility lies in mutual respect, emotional support, and the sharing of dreams and creativity. A balanced relationship will help Pisces swim smoothly through the waters of love.
